    I am trying to work out a tripod for my use - I am 2m tall (approx

    6'7"). I want to avoid vibrations and thus want a tripod that is

    tall w/out winding up the centre column.

     

    My options seem to be:

    - Benbo 2

    - Bogen 3051 / Manfrotto 058

    - Bogen 3046 / Manfrotto 028

     

    (I am in Aust, hence the Manfrotto codes are applicable).

     

    I will use it mainly for landscapes, night shots. My lenses are

    currently 70-200 f2.8 (Canon) and 17-40 F4; and am thinking about the

    400 5.6. I may get a 500 f4 is the very distant future (maybe so

    distant it will be never!).

     

    Comments or suggestions? I know these are going to be heavy (the

    Benbo is perhaps the lightest). Seems to be something I cannot get

    away from when I want a tall tripod.

     

    I have heard some comments about the Benbos not being very stable.

    The flexibility of the Benbo appeals, but its not a big concern and

    not as important as stability.

     

    I cannot get Uni-loc brand in Aust else it would also be in the list.
